Minecraft Color Codes (and Format Codes) In Minecraft, there are a number of built-in color codes and format codes that you can use in chat and game commands.
Color codes can be used to change the color of text in the game, assign team colors, and customize the color of dyed leather armor. Minecraft: Java Edition utilizes color codes, a series of numbers and letters prefixed by the symbol § or & symbol, to modify the color of in-game text.
